Saygus VPhone V1 Android Smartphone Appear at FCC

A new Android slider smartphone called Saygus VPhone V1 is visiting FCC waiting for their approval. Will be the third Android phone from Verizon, Saygus VPhone V1 will be eleased by the carrier by early 2010.
Specs wise, Saygus VPhone V1 packs a 3.5 inch capacitive touchscreen display with a 800 x 480 pixel resolution, 5MP camera, Wifi, GPS, MicroSD card slot, FM radio and powered by a 624MHz Marvell PXA310 processor.
